如何用AI语音聊天进行智能问答与知识检索
随着科技的飞速发展,人工智能技术已经渗透到了我们生活的方方面面。其中,AI语音聊天作为一种新兴的交流方式,越来越受到人们的关注。本文将通过讲述一个AI语音聊天助手的故事,向大家展示如何利用AI语音聊天进行智能问答与知识检索。
故事的主人公是一位名叫小明的年轻人。小明是一名大学生,对人工智能充满了好奇。他经常在网络上看到各种关于AI技术的新闻和文章,对AI语音聊天尤为感兴趣。于是,他决定自己尝试开发一个AI语音聊天助手。
小明首先在网络上查阅了大量的资料,了解了AI语音聊天的基本原理和实现方法。他发现,目前市场上的AI语音聊天助手大多基于自然语言处理(NLP)技术,通过训练大量的语料库,让机器能够理解和生成自然语言。于是,小明决定从NLP技术入手,尝试开发自己的AI语音聊天助手。
在开发过程中,小明遇到了许多困难。首先,他需要收集大量的语料库,以便让机器能够学习和理解各种语言表达。为此,他花费了大量的时间和精力,从网络上收集了大量的文本、音频和视频资料。接着,小明开始尝试使用现有的NLP工具,如BERT、GPT等,对语料库进行训练。然而,这些工具的参数设置和训练过程非常复杂,小明在尝试了多次之后,仍然无法得到满意的效果。
就在小明快要放弃的时候,他突然想到了一个大胆的想法:为什么不自己编写一个简单的NLP模型呢?于是,小明开始学习Python编程,并尝试使用TensorFlow和Keras等深度学习框架来构建自己的NLP模型。经过反复尝试和修改,小明终于成功地训练出了一个能够进行基本问答的AI语音聊天助手。
小明的AI语音聊天助手名叫“小智”。小智能够理解用户的问题,并根据所学到的知识给出相应的回答。为了丰富小智的知识库,小明不断地在小智身上添加新的功能。他让小智能够检索网络上的信息,回答用户关于新闻、天气、股票等问题。此外,小明还让小智能够与用户进行简单的对话,如聊天、讲故事等。
有一天,小明的好友小李听说他开发了一个AI语音聊天助手,便好奇地下载了小智,并开始与小智聊天。小李问:“小智,你知道最近的天气怎么样吗?”小智立刻回答:“当然,今天的天气是晴转多云,最高温度25摄氏度,最低温度15摄氏度。”小李又问:“那你能帮我查一下今天的股市行情吗?”小智迅速地检索了网络上的信息,回答道:“今天的股市行情如下……”
小李对小智的表现非常满意,认为它比一般的智能问答系统要强大得多。于是,他开始向周围的朋友推荐小智。渐渐地,越来越多的人开始使用小智,它逐渐在网络上走红。
然而,小智的知名度越高,小明面临的挑战也就越大。他发现,随着用户数量的增加,小智的知识库越来越难以维护。为了解决这个问题,小明决定采用云计算技术,将小智部署在云端。这样一来,无论用户数量如何增加,小智都能够快速地处理用户请求,并保证其性能。
在云端的帮助下,小智的知识库得到了极大的扩展。小明不断地更新小智,让它能够回答更多的问题。此外,小明还让小智具备了一定的学习能力,能够根据用户的反馈不断优化自己的回答。
如今,小智已经成为了一个功能强大的AI语音聊天助手。它不仅能够回答用户的问题,还能与用户进行简单的对话,甚至能够辅助用户进行日常生活中的各种任务。小明深感欣慰,因为他知道,自己的努力没有白费。
通过这个故事,我们可以看到,AI语音聊天助手在智能问答与知识检索方面具有巨大的潜力。只要我们不断优化算法、丰富知识库,AI语音聊天助手就能够为人们提供更加便捷、高效的服务。
当然,AI语音聊天助手的发展还面临着许多挑战。例如,如何保证其回答的准确性、如何处理用户隐私等问题。但相信在不久的将来,随着技术的不断进步,这些问题都将得到解决。而小智的故事,也将成为AI语音聊天助手发展历程中的一个缩影。
猜你喜欢:智能对话